Mooresville mother charged with murder in toddler’s death

MOORESVILLE, N.C. – A local woman is charged with murder in the death of her toddler. Riley Wormington is accused of letting her child under two-years-old ingest a lethal dose of fentanyl. Despite life-saving efforts from first responders, the toddler died February 13th at a home on Ridge Avenue in Mooresville.

Mooresville Police investigators tell us 23-year-old Wormington left the state shortly after giving birth to another child and while the investigation into the death of her toddler continued. She was arrested this week in Denver, Colorado and will be transported back to Iredell County.

Wormington is charged with 2nd degree murder, felony child abuse, and drug charges. She’s also been charged in relation to the care of her newborn with felony child abuse.
